Egypt summons US, Russian and EU ambassadors
Egypt-Palestine, Politics, 3/30/2002

Egyptian Foreign Minister Ahmed Maher yesterday summoned the ambassadors of the United States, Russia and EU for discussing the developments and the Israeli attack against the Palestinian President's headquarters.180

Maher also telephoned UN Secretary General Kofi Annan to post him with the latest developments and the need for the UN interference to halt the Israeli aggression against the Palestinian people.

Maher also made contacts and consultations with a number of world Foreign Ministers for discussing the deteriorating situation and the flagrant Israeli aggression on Palestinians.

Ambassadors sent a message to French Foreign Minister Hubert Vedrine calling for the French and European interference for saving the Palestinian President and people in Ramallah.
